[CMSC 411 Home] | [Syllabus] | [Project] | [VHDL resource] | [Homework 1-6] | [lecture notes]

[Homework 7-12] | [news] | [files]

CMSC 411 Computer Architecture Syllabus Fall 2016

Class schedule, topic and assignments Tuesday and Thursday 2:30pm-3:45pm SHH 150 Reading assignments: from fourth or later edition of textbook. Homework and projects are due midnight on the date listed. Computer Engineering majors have additional tasks in some assignments.

Lec Date Subject Reading Homework assigned due 1. 9/1 Introduction, terminology 1.1-1.5 HW1 2. 9/6 Benchmarks 1.7 3. 9/8 Performance, 1.4 HW2 HW1 4. 9/13 CPU operation skim 2.1-2.11 read p78 5. 9/15 Instructions and registers skim 2.1-2.11 HW3 HW2 read p121 6. 9/20 VHDL introduction VHDL web Pages 7. 9/22 Arithmetic C.5-C.6 HW4 HW3 VHDL WEB Pages 8. 9/27 ALU 3.1-3.2 9. 9/29 Multiply 3.3 HW5 10. 10/4 Divide 3.4 11. 10/6 Floating Point 3.5 HW4* 12. 10/11 VHDL - circuits and debugging VHDL web pages HW6 HW5 13. 10/13 Microprogramming - review web pages 14. 10/18 mid-term exam study 15. 10/20 Control Unit 5.1-5.4 16. 10/25 Pipelining 1 4.1-4.3 HW6* 17. 10/27 Pipelining 2 4.5-4.6 HW7 18. 11/1 Project outline and VHDL VHDL web pages proj1 19. 11/3 Pipelining Data Forwarding 4.7 proj2a HW7 20. 11/8 Hazard and stalls 4.7 HW8 proj2b 21. 11/10 Cache 5.1-5.2 HW9 Proj1* 22. 11/15 Cache performance 5.3 proj3a HW8 23. 11/17 Virtual memory 1 5.4 HW10 HW9 Proj2a* 24. 11/22 Virtual memory 2 web page proj3b Thanksgiving holiday 25. 11/29 I/O types and performance 6.3-6.7 HW11 HW10 Proj2b* 26. 12/1 DVR, DVD-RW, CDR, CD-RW web page 27. 12/6 Busses, I/O-processor connection 6.5 HW12 HW11 Proj3a* 28. 12/8 Multiprocessors study 29. 12/13 Study Guide study 30. 12/15 Final Exam 1:00 pm-3:00 pm room SSH 150 (Bring ID card, show when turning in exam.) HW12 Proj3b No late homework accepted after midnight 12/22/2016 Late penalty is 10% per week, penalty limit 50%. * submitted, not graded until next weekend (not late for a while) Projects are graded only once, do not do "submit" until finished. Check will be made for copying after midnight 12/22. Missing or copied projects get a zero.

Other links

Last updated 12/14/2016